    The GM Technical Center was inaugurated in 1956 as General Motors's primary design and engineering center, located in Warren, Michigan. In 2000 the center was listed on the National Register of Historic Places , and fourteen years later it was designated a National Historic Landmark , primarily for its architecture.

    The GM Tech Center was designed by architect Eero Saarinen. Construction began in 1949 and continued until 1955, with a total cost of approximately US$ 100,000,000. The campus was ceremonially opened by Dwight D. Eisenhower on May 16, 1956, and in 1986 the complex was designated by the American Institute of Architects as the most outstanding ...
